We are looking for a Senior Finance Analyst – Pricing to deliver accurate, data-based information and provide value building inputs. This role will play an integral part of the Finance team that directly helps secure the success of the company.
This FP&A role is responsible for leading the vehicle, merchandise, and accessories pricing as well as gross margin forecasting and budgeting consolidation activities within Finance. This position will work with cross-functional teams and support executive decision making and communication to the board of directors.

The Role:

  • Provide Marketing Equation analysis and Marketing Feature List price development and refinement across a global landscape
  • Contribute competitive pricing insights and price positioning (using competitor benchmarking data and market analysis) as well as vehicle margin analyses and business equations to support Marketing Finance decisions
  • Drive process with cross-functional teams to gather inputs and ensure accuracy of global pricebook set-up and maintenance in ERP and related systems
  • Actively participate with cross-functional teams in the development and alignment of vehicle product timing, pricing, life cycles, volumes, take rates, and profitability
  • Facilitate operating team alignment and assessments by presenting data in cohesive reports that provide clear communication and recommendations Consolidate and analyze financial data including reconciliations, period-to-period variance analysis, establishing vehicle revenue targets, analyzing operating cost changes with insightful explanations. Compile, track and analyze vehicle revenue and cost elements
  • Provide objective business consultancy and financial guidance to the company
  • Partner closely with all internal stakeholders and operating teams to provide clear financial inputs and provide guidance on operational decisions
  • Additional ad-hoc assignments and projects supporting departments across the organization including month-end financial reporting, longer-term Business Plan development, benchmarking and process analysis
  • Provide new perspective to identify and propose opportunities for improvement across processes and business functions

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Engineering or related field
  • Finance analyst experience at an Automotive OEM – required
  • At least 4 years’ relevant industry experience, with a minimum of 2 years of financial variance analysis and retail pricing experience. Be able to demonstrate existing Pricing and Marketing Finance understanding
  • Proven technical, quantitative and critical-thinking skills, high level of independent judgment, initiative and creativity to identify and clearly communicate key performance drivers to management
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and assignments with a high degree of autonomy and accountability for results
  • Demonstrated effective written, interpersonal and oral communication skills
  • Established ability using SAP and Microsoft Office software with a particularly high proficiency with Excel
